Handover Note — Q3 Cash-Flow Forecast

From: R. Calloway, outgoing Finance Director
To: I. Merrow, incoming Finance Director

The Q3 forecast assumes the Tarnwell contract renews at current rates and that receivables from the Ellsmoor division normalize by August. Weekly variance tracking is owned by the planning team; review cadence is Mondays. Capex for the Brindell site is deferred pending board approval. Department heads have the summary deck. Strategic assumptions underpinning the forecast are documented in the confidential note below.

internal memo for kawip-hadug: Headcount on the Wenwyn team goes from 7 to 140 by the end of January. Gross margin on Wenwyn came in at 20 percent against a plan of 15 percent.

**Action Item 7 (owner: Prya, due before next release cut):** The tile-rendering cache in Glacierboard served stale tiles for ~40 minutes because eviction keys ignored the zoom level. Fix is merged, but we need a release gate: no cut ships until the cache-consistency smoke test passes on staging. Marta, please wire this into your checklist so we don't rediscover it the hard way. Test definitions, rollback steps, and the gate config are documented on the internal page below.

wiki page, bagaf-fawip: https://harbor.tolvaqsys.local/pages/repo/pages/secrets/eac969ffc71f356b

Welcome to on-call for the Glimmerpane design system! Our snapshot tests live in the `snapcheck` suite and run on every merge to main. If a UI component changes visually, the diff bot flags it — usually it's an intentional tweak, so just approve the new baseline. If it's 2am and snapshots are failing across the board, it's almost always a font-loading race, not your problem. To unlock the baseline store and re-approve snapshots in bulk, use the recovery passphrase below.

recovery phrase for tahag-taguf: wenix-caswyn